自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(13)
  • 资源 (1)
  • 收藏
  • 关注

转载 HashSet和TreeSet

转自:http://blog.csdn.net/cyq1984/article/details/6925536Set是java中一个不包含重复元素的collection。更正式地说,set 不包含满足 e1.equals(e2) 的元素对e1 和e2,并且最多包含一个 null 元素。正如其名称所暗示的,此接口模仿了数学上的set 抽象。HashSet与TreeSet都是基于Set

2013-09-30 15:32:11 464

转载 Java实现的几个常用排序算法详细解读

转自:http://vipshichg.iteye.com/blog/1948928排序算法很多地方都会用到,近期又重新看了一遍算法,并自己简单地实现了一遍,特此记录下来,为以后复习留点材料。废话不多说,下面逐一看看经典的排序算法: 1. 选择排序选择排序的基本思想是遍历数组的过程中,以 i 代表当前需要排序的序号,则需要在剩余的 [i…n-

2013-09-29 14:05:01 495

转载 解决ant编译“资源不足”的问题

增加分派内存大小在build.xml 中增加这个fork="true" memorymaximumsize="512M"结果如下: fork="true" memorymaximumsize="512M" includes="**/*.java" classpathref="class_path">重新执行,问题解决. 下面再转载一篇别人的文章:      

2013-09-23 18:18:28 2556

转载 8 张图助你更好地理解 Java

转自:http://www.iteye.com/news/28319所谓一图胜万言,本文中的这些图都是从ProgramCreek网站中的Java教程中通过票选选出来的。可以帮助你很好地回顾Java的一些知识,如果你是一个初学者,也可以很好地帮助你理解Java。你可以通过标题上的链接来阅读更详细的内容。1.  字符串不变性下图显示了下面的代码发生了什么事情。

2013-09-23 13:42:58 526

原创 effective java 创建和销毁对象

1. 考虑用静态工厂方法替代构造器       与构造器相比的优势:            静态方法有名称,可以更好的表述方法含义。            不必在每次调用的时候都创建一个新对象。            可以返回类型的任何子类型对象。            在创建参数化实例的时候,使代码变得更加简洁。       缺点:            类如果不含有

2013-09-10 14:15:15 475

原创 北漂半载

从四月到九月,北京从春寒料峭到骄阳似火,转眼又到了微凉的秋天。  回首这半年的折腾,真实惨不忍睹。  我为什么要来北京,驱动力很清楚:工作,感情,个人愿望!

2013-09-06 13:55:24 620

原创 dorado 动态改变 dataType 属性

通常情况下,我们都是预先设置好 dataType 中某一个属性的初始化参数,然后使用一个dataSet 指向dataType ,最后使用一个表单autoForm 指向 dataSet。但是有时候我们需要在程序中动态的设置 dataType的某一个属性,并要求在界面上能够显示出改变。比如:dataType 中有 applyType属性,applyContent属性。我需要根据applyT

2013-09-06 11:40:22 2906 3

转载 深入分析Java使用+和StringBuilder进行字符串拼接的差异

转自:http://bsr1983.iteye.com/blog/1935856深入分析Java使用+和StringBuilder进行字符串拼接的差异        今天看到有网友在我的博客留言,讨论java中String在进行拼接时使用+和StringBuilder和StringBuffer中的执行速度差异很大,而且之前看的书上说java在编译的时候会自动将+替换为S

2013-09-05 18:52:57 671

转载 Object.wait()与Object.notify()的用法

转自 http://www.cnblogs.com/xwdreamer/archive/2012/05/12/2496843.htmlobject.wait()和object.notify()和object.notifyall()object.wait()方法:让拥有object对象的锁的线程进入等待状态,并释放对象锁。 object.wait()和object.notif

2013-09-04 17:11:33 554

转载 TCP协议三次握手

转自 http://www.cnblogs.com/rootq/articles/1377355.htmlTCP协议三次握手过程分析TCP(Transmission Control Protocol) 传输控制协议TCP是主机对主机层的传输控制协议,提供可靠的连接服务,采用三次握手确认建立一个连接:位码即tcp标志位,有6种标示:SYN(synchronous建立联机)

2013-09-04 15:06:06 478

原创 java.util.ConcurrentModificationException

不能在对一个List进行遍历的时候将其中的元素删除掉从API中可以看到List等Collection的实现并没有同步化,如果在多 线程应用程序中出现同时访问,而且出现修改操作的时候都要求外部操作同步化;调用Iterator操作获得的Iterator对象在多线程修改Set的时 候也自动失效,并抛出java.util.ConcurrentModificationException。这种实现

2013-09-04 11:07:06 588

转载 Flyweight

转自 http://baike.baidu.com/link?url=IHtfkx1jZ5UlfJpQv1FFVC-Eqo0vzFcNhbttZY96mAzDp-gmthFOpxm7-54Yq2gJsIUcgxlg7-G-8krqlvLka_Flyweight模式定义设计模式中的享元模式,避免大量拥有相同内容的小类的开销(如耗费内存),使大家共享一个类(元类).为什么使

2013-09-03 16:15:58 464

转载 Java集合类详解

转自 http://blog.csdn.net/softwave/article/details/4166598集合类说明及区别Collection├List│├LinkedList│├ArrayList│└Vector│ └Stack└SetMap├Hashtable├HashMap└WeakHashMapCollection接口  C

2013-09-02 08:54:21 603

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除